"Peter and Esther visit a restaurant for a three-course meal. On the menu there are 4 starters, 5 main courses and 3 sweets. Peter and Esther each order a starter, a main course and a sweet.

(i) Calculate the number of ways in which Peter may choose his three-course meal.

(ii) Suppose that Peter and Esther choose different dishes from each other.

(A) Show that the number of possible combinations of starters is 6.

(B) Calculate the number of possible combinations of 6 dishes for both meals."

(i) This is simply 4x5x3 = 60. Imagine a tree diagram with each possible combination... how many branches will there be?

(ii-A) You are trying to calculate the number of combinations of 2 starters, where they are both different. There are 4 possible starters, hence you want the number of ways to pick 2 from 4, which is nCr (number of ways to pick r items from n objects). Hence 4C2, which is 6.

(ii-B) Similarly to part (ii-A), except you need to do the same for the main course and dessert. There are 5 mains, and you want 2, hence 5C2 = 10. There are 3 sweets, and you want 2, hence 3C2 = 3. Multiply these two numbers together along with the answer to (ii-A): 6x10x3 = 180.
